Have not done much milling on my 2Hp Bridgport and still getting the feel of it. The little I have done have chipped a couple of HSS end mills and turned out decent work pieces but am running low on the few end mills that came with the BP.
Time to purchase more cutters. Will price South Africa but more than likely buy in USA as my wife is currently visiting for Thanksgiving. So far have been machining cast iron, mild steel and EN8 Steel. Have a few SS jobs in the pipeline.
I have metric R8 collets but no R8 weldon endmill holders, so will be buying these. An ER collet system I will purchase at a later date when I use the mill more frequently not sure on the size. Majority of my drills and endmills I have are metric.
Q1- What would be the ideal size and flute end mill to buy for this machine for the above materials I am planning to mill? Do i go shotgun approach and get like 10 of each from 4mm- 20mm? I know it depends on what the job is, but that is the unknown. Never know whats gonna break and needs repair or make a new part.
Q2- What are the most common sizes you guys normally use?
Q3- Carbide vs HSS? A fellow PM was selling some 9/16 carbide mills for $7 ea which sounds fantastic from here esp when I purchased a dormer 6mm carbide end mill for some bennex plate for $136 USD!!
Q4- Do i get some insert mills? 1/2", 3/4"?
Q5- If fellow PMs dont have any for sale how to detect which ones to purchase on ebay or Amazon?
Q6- Was going to buy a bunch of inserts for the lathe tools but see prices on ebay all over. If sticking with brand names are they fake, who are decent sellers to purchase from and how much should I pay for say CNMG, TNMG & WMNG etc? (16mm and 20mm tool holders)
Basically just wanting a good supply of the most common mills I need.
There is a company in SA selling resharpened HSS end mills but last I checked their prices where close to new price, so stayed away.
Last lot of carbide inserts I bought a few years back from SA were Korloy and they hold up well.
